BMW 2002 & 320i Dual Sidedraft Manifold Unlike anything you've seen and tried, this manifold has a built in water jacket.It will keep the manifold at the same temperature as the head for easier starts and better performance by preventing the formation of fuel condensation on the walls of the manifold. You will no longer need a 320i bypass hose.

Buy with confidence as you will be pleased with the performance. Here is the mechanism by which this manifold works for all those that are confused by the crossover manifold concept... The manifold runners on cylinders 1&4 connect to one venturi (V1) of the carb, therefore cyls 2&3 connect to the other side of the carb (V2). With the firing order being 1,3,4,2 the intake pulse demand from the first cylinder(1) draws mixture from V1 venturi of the carb. The next one demanding a lungful is cylinder 3, which draws from venturi V2. The next one in the sequence is cylinder 4, which draws from the same venturi (V1) as number 1 cylinder and then number 2 cylinder draws from number 2 venturi(V2). You can see that the carb takes turns in feeding the cylinders due to the crossover design of the runners feeding each cylinder a fresh batch of air/fuel from the carb, alternating throats as it goes! The patented crossover design does just that- it splits the pulses (in firing order sequence) that are created by the downward movement of the piston so as one throat receives one pulse, and the next pulse (in the firing order sequence) goes to the other side of the carb. This way the pulses that the carb sees are evenly spaced, allowing better cylinder filling than the conventional design, hence more power and torque. Holley patented a style of manifold like this for the dual plane 4bbl S/B Chev, as they suffer from the same problem of all the available mixture being siphoned off from one side of the manifold, leaving nothing for the next one in the sequence (The firing order for the Chev is 1, 8, 4, 3, 6, 5 and then the cylinder next in sequence is siphoning 7, then obviously 2).
